Bill Summary

Authorizing a county or municipal corporation to designate certain fire marshals with the approval of the State Fire Marshal or to request that the State Fire Marshal designate certain fire marshals and requiring the State Fire Marshal to adopt certain regulations governing the qualifications, training, standards, and certification of designees; requiring installation of certain fire prevention in certain high-rise residential buildings, beginning October 1, 2026; etc.

AI Summary

This bill makes several changes to fire safety regulations, including allowing counties and municipalities to designate assistant State Fire Marshals with approval from the State Fire Marshal, who will also establish regulations for their training and certification in areas like fire inspection, plan review, and investigation. It also redefines "high-rise building" for fire safety purposes and mandates the installation of automatic fire sprinklers in residential rental high-rise buildings undergoing substantial renovations starting October 1, 2026, with specific requirements for fire-resistant construction and other safety features. Furthermore, the bill establishes a program to license and regulate fire alarm system technicians and companies, outlining requirements for their training, professional standards, and liability insurance, similar to existing regulations for fire sprinkler contractors.
